I designed the finisher medals for the inaugural Las Vegas Marathon. There were around 6,000 poeple that ran this race. I designed a medal for three different distances; Marathon, Half Marathon and The 7.02 miles (a nod to the area code).
My concept was a poker chip but each distance showed a unique scene from that course. The marathon depicts Red Rock Canyon where the marathon starts in that area.

The Half Marathon depicts the Arts District. My process was to take photos of these areas and vectorize them in illustrator. I then made them 3 different colors since these medals are done in 3 different layers. I had to figure out with each medal how I would change the image so it worked with 3 layers.


The last medal is The 702. This is the area code in Las Vegas. It ran 7.02 miles. This medal depicted the finish line on Fremont Street. It was an awesome finish line and many of the participants loved this medal the most even though it was for the shortest distance. All of these medals have an "antique finish" that makes it look more distressed and classic instead of a cheap enamel medal.
